我在1.9.0pythonSDK引擎上尝试了helloworld示例应用程序https://developers.google.com/appengine/docs/python/gettingstartedpython27/helloworld,并得到了一个“在此服务器上找不到所请求的URL /”错误。奇怪的是,当用其他3种浏览器进行测试时,它也能工作。运行dev_appserver.py helloworld/的日志显示
信息2014-03-01 15:43:33,999 module.py:612]默认:"GET / HTTP/1.0“200 13 信息2014-03-01 15:43:49,510 module.py:612]默认:"GET / HTTP/1.1“200 13 信息2014-03-01 15:43:50,169 module.py:612]默认:"GET /favicon.ico HTTP/1.1“404 154 信息2014-03-01 15:45:03,572 module.py:612]默认值:"GET / HTTP/1.0“200 13
一个404错误对应于使用火狐访问应用程序,而其他的都是成功的在lynx,铬和w3m。有人能帮忙看看它是否能被复制吗?因此,火狐似乎坚持要寻找/favicon.ico。为什么?真奇怪!
发布于 2014-03-03 19:18:48
W3C于2005年10月发布了一份名为如何向您的站点添加偏好图标的指南。/favicon.ico请求实现了此处描述的不推荐的方法2,主要是为了与旧服务器和浏览器向后兼容。建议的方法1相当于以下内容(与您自己的内容合并):
<html>
<head>
<link rel="icon" type="image/ico" href="my-cool-icon.ico" />
</head>
<body>
<!-- yada yada -->
</body>
</html>我希望但不能保证Firefox应该首先考虑显式链接,如果找到该图标,则跳过对/favicon.ico的请求。我想知道它是否适用于您的各种浏览器。
https://stackoverflow.com/questions/22117309
复制相似问题